On 6 April 1798, George Johnston received a land grant of 172 acres (70 ha) in the district from Governor Hunter.The grant was made up of a number of parcels of land including 12 acres (4.9 ha) at Marquee Point, 70 acres (28 ha) adjacent to "Strongs Farm" and 90 acres (36 ha) above "Red Bank".

    Oran Park is of state heritage significance for its association with a number of prominent people, including members of the colonial ruling class of NSW in the 19th century. [ 1 ] The Oran Park property was originally part of a 2000-acre land grant, awarded by Governor Lachlan Macquarie to William Douglas Campbell in 1815.

Mudall Parish (Oxley County), New South Wales is a rural locality of Bogan Shire and a civil parish of Oxley County, New South Wales, [1] a Cadastral divisions of New South Wales. [2] The parish is on the Bogan River south of Nyngan. [3] The topography is flat with a Köppen climate classification of BsK (Hot semi arid). [4]
